Good value if you already have Prime

Review of Amazon Prime Video

3.5/5.0
Current Subscriber
Subscribed for 48 months
Amazon Prime Video is a strange beast. The originals are hit-or-miss but when they hit, they hit hard — The Boys, Fallout, and Reacher are all excellent. The real value is that it comes bundled with your Prime shipping subscription, so it feels free. The interface is probably the worst of all major streamers though — everything is cluttered with rental and purchase options mixed in with included content. They also started showing ads in 2024 unless you pay an extra $2.99/month, which felt like a slap in the face for existing Prime members. Thursday Night Football is a nice exclusive if you are into the NFL.
